Carbon Energy (ASX:CNX) (OTCMKTS:CNXAY) is building a gas business, utilising its unique keyseam technology.
The Company is committed to providing industrial gas users with an affordable and secure source of high quality feedstock, as gas prices remain strong, through increased demand across our key markets.
Carbon Energy is the only company to complete a full-lifecycle, commercial scalable underground gasification trial. The Company's keyseam technology has successfully accomplished all the recommendations outlined by the Queensland government's Independent Scientific Panel (ISP) which included intense, independent environmental scrutiny.

Carbon Energy Limited (ASX:CNX)(PINK:CNXAF) today released further results of its drilling programme which has been in progress at Bloodwood Creek and Kogan. The latest analysis of the drilling data confirms a much greater than expected increase (+125%) to its total resource which has risen from 296.9 million tonnes to 668 million tonnes (indicated and inferred). 364 million tonnes of this resource is in coal seams greater than 5m thick which are an optimal target for underground coal gasification.
